United Drilling Tools Secures ₹4.78 Crore Order from ONGC for Stabilizer Supply
United Drilling Tools Limited received an order from ONGC for the supply of Stabilizers. The estimated contract value is ₹4.78 Crore. The order is to be executed within 6 months.

United Drilling Tools Limited has announced the receipt of a domestic order from Oil and Natural Gas Corporation Limited (ONGC) for the supply of Stabilizers. This order is considered to be in the ordinary course of business for the company.
The contract's estimated value is ₹4,78,27,782 (Four Crore Seventy Eight Lacs Twenty Seven Thousand Seven Hundred Eighty Two Only). The supply of Stabilizers is expected to be executed within a period of 6 months from the date of the order.
There are no promoter or promoter group interests in the entity awarding the order, and the contract does not fall within related party transactions, being conducted at an arm's length basis.
